Trimming primarily cuts back a tree to control the outward growth of unruly branches. The goal of this may be to achieve a pleasing shape or to reduce the size of the tree so it does not outgrow its space. Pruning, on the other hand, is the practice of removing dead, dying, weak, or broken branches, with the aim of improving the health of the tree. While the terms trimming and pruning may be used interchangeably in some cases, they are distinct services that are both individually necessary.

Why Trimming & Pruning Are Important

Both trimming and pruning should be part of the routine care you request for your trees. But why are they so important? Let’s walk through the reasons.

Removing Hazards

A tree that has not been pruned for a while could have dead or weak branches that may threaten to fall the next time a storm passes through. It’s crucial that you request tree pruning in Walled Lake every few years to remove any parts of the tree that are at risk of falling.

Stability

Sometimes the outer branches of trees grow in a way that destabilizes the structure of the tree. In these cases, we might recommend a trimming service called crown reduction, which cuts back the outward growth of the branches. This keeps the tree a manageable size for its structure.

Health

Pruning methods like crown thinning remove branches from the interior of the crown of the tree. This allows for more air flow and sunlight throughout the tree, not just to the outer branches, which encourages more distributed growth. It also reduces the chance of diseases and fungus in the inner branches.

Appearance

How Trimming & Pruning Should Factor Into Your Maintenance

Both tree trimming and pruning in Walled Lake and beyond should become part of the ongoing maintenance you provide for your trees. But how does that work in practice? The frequency of both services depends on the type of tree. If you primarily have evergreens or conifers in your yard, like pines, spruces, and hemlock, you will not need to have them pruned or trimmed very often, unless they are growing in undesirable directions.

Deciduous trees are a different matter entirely. Your maples, oaks, and beech trees, to name a few, will require trimming every year or two, plus pruning every two to three years. The actual frequency will depend from tree to tree, and it is best to consult with an expert at Adrian’s Tree Service to plan a practical schedule.

While trimming or pruning are possible at different times throughout the year, we recommend requesting these services during the dormant season for the trees. This is during late winter or early spring. If performed before the tree starts growing in the spring, pruning will encourage new expansion. Once we enter spring in earnest, pruning will cut back the signs of new growth, rather than spurring them on.
